3 singers place in top 5 of vocal competition

Three Chamber Singers took more than half of the top five winning spots in the Southern California Vocal Association’s Vocal Solo Competition.

After singing for a crowd of nearly 800 on May 6, Julian Hicks ’08 took first place, followed by Carolyn Berliner ’07 in second and Kurt Kanazawa ’07 in fourth.

Throughout Los Angeles, 150 singers competed in the initial round.
Nineteen Bel Canto and Chamber Singers members took part in the first round of the competition. Five made it through to the second round. 

The three singers admitted to the third round were selected by professional adjudicators, who announced the order of the winners at the final performance.

“It’s an incredibly rewarding learning experience for our singers, and not just for those who were fortunate enough to have been chosen to compete in the semifinals and finals,” Choral Director Rodger Guerrero said.

“I have never been prouder of a group than this one.”
